Laura lives an isolated life with her father, alone in a castle in the Austrian wilderness.

When the mysterious Carmilla, a strange and beautiful lady, arrives in the night, no one suspects the supernatural occurrences that follow.

But still more unsuspected is the tempestuous romance that blooms between the two young women, and Carmilla's nightmarish secret.

Written 26 years before Stoker's 'Dracula', 'Carmilla' is the original vampire novel.

Sheridan Le Fanu combines a chilling Gothic atmosphere with horrifying episodes, boldly exploring the sexual desires of his heroines, and establishing the image of the female vampire.
